Invariably when I visit any of the โBigโ cities located around our fabulous world I like to take myself out for a โspecialโ dinner and so when visiting Sydney recently I did a little research and settled on The WoodCut at the new and somewhat controversial Barangaroo Crown Hotel and Casino. Finding a venue to dine solo in these days is neither as haphazard or difficult as it used to be, although given that my chosen dining date was the Friday before Christmas meant that some of the restaurants that I was hoping to dine out were completely booked out. WoodCut also had no availability via their online booking facility however a quick call later I secured a seat at the Chefโs table which I always enjoy .. both for the entertainment value of watching the โkitchen balletโ but also for the often convivial nature of this dining area and the chance to chat to other like minded solo diners and travellers. I chose to have a cocktail upstairs at Cinq on the 26th floor however in hindsight I think I would have preferred to have had a pre-dinner drink at the bar at WoodCut which looked quite nice. Cinq was posey and fairly ordinary .. but the less said about that the better. On arriving I was pleasantly greeted, escorted to my seat and given the option of a few different areas around the kitchen bar area dependant on my bent for viewing. I opted for a seat close to the corner which allowed for a view of the action without the fear of it being too smokey or noisy. I was quickly offered a menu and asked if I would like sparkling water. I was then given time to peruse the drink and food menu before the lovely wait person came to take my order. On ordering the sirloin I was politely informed that due to the cut of beef with bone in it would possibly take 40 minutes, which seemed a little excessive given that the restaurant was really not very busy and I was having my steak rare, but none the less it was good to be informed. My wine arrived promptly and as there was in fact one other solo diner at the table we chatted amicably until each of our meals arrived. I could not fault the steak, it was cooked perfectly and the sides of spinach and potato were delicious and very generous in size. Suggestive feedback on the meal would be that the sides could be offered in smaller solo portions as I would imagine that they are designed to be shared by the table and as it was of course just me .,. there was no way I could consume all of them however the price of each side significantly increased the final bill. Just as I finished my glass of wine the waitperson magically arrived to ask if I would like another glass and as I was still working my way through the very large sirloin and massive sides I of course replied โwhy notโ. So the verdict โฆ. Delicious but.very much on the expensive side and smaller meal portion options would be appreciated .. oh and the fact that I was charged $6 for the glass of sparkling water was .. well just a little offensive .. at these prices and the fact that the sparkling is from a communal bottle made on premise with their soda-stream system .. seriously Crown .. this could be complimentary. All in All though a delicious entertaining meal and I would definitely recommend and return.

Ate at Woodcut tonight (3 Nov) in Crown Towers Sydney for the 1st time. They use wood to cook. Steak was good. Saw a lot of diners ordering octopus which i did not. Never mind, next time. Total damage A$258. I ordered the following: a) Grilled Black Tasmsnian Garlic Bread - A$12 b) Wagyu beef skewer -A$22 c) Stone Axe Sirloin Steak and Green Peppercorn Sauce - A$185 d) Skin on Chips - A$13.00 e) Cheesecake cocktail - A$26.00 Total -A$258

I was disappointed with this restaurant. Went for a business lunch and initially I was impressed with the pleasant atmosphere and nice view outside. The menu though was quite limited for what I thought was a steak restaurant. We ended up ordering among other things the 800g eye fillet which was no word of a lie, circa 400g, and not particularly nice. Oh did I mention it was $290!!! If you want steak then go to Rockpool (I'm not even a Rockpool fan but it walks all over this place). If you want a view go to Otto - much nicer. The fish was extremely buttery and I found it to be inedible. Service was a bit average too. Won't be going back.
